Beechnut Bracelet
A rigid bangle bracelet with a fringe of sculptural teardrop-shaped pendants evoking the beechnut motif common in Etruscan jewelry. Loren said, "I was drawn to the shimmering fringe of beechnut common in ancient Mediterranean jewelry. The beechnut was a crucial wild food source, thought to be one of the earliest consumed by humans. The teardrop shape makes a beautiful, glittering pendant celebrated as a symbol of abundance."
